Studies investigating the efficacy of the Mulligan technique and ozone therapy in patients with shoulder impingement syndrome are limited in the literature. The aim of this study was to compare the effectiveness of Mulligan mobilization method and ozone therapy in patients with shoulder impingement syndrome. Ozone therapy will be practiced to study group. Mulligan mobilization will be practiced to control group. Pain, range of motion and function will be assessed before and after treatment.
